Appearance, ergonomics and display of Samsung Galaxy Note 7

The new phablet retains the basic features of its predecessor in its appearance, making it recognizable as a representative of the Note line. The design of the smartphone combines elements taken from models and . In the previous model, only the back panel was rounded, but in the new product, both the front and back surfaces are equally rounded. Due to this, an impression of completeness is created; the appearance of the “seven” is pleasant and harmonious. Although the screen is rounded at the edges, it is not too much. Everything has been done just enough so as not to affect the convenience of handwriting input, since the usable area for the S Pen with excessive screen curvature will be smaller, and this is completely useless.

Despite the dimensions of the device, it is very convenient to use; it fits perfectly in the hand, since the body is noticeably narrowed. Like the latest flagships from the Korean vendor, the Galaxy Note 7 is made using glass and metal. The back is quite slippery, you can accidentally drop your smartphone if you are not careful. However, the case completely corrects the situation. A freshly baked device can benefit from protection from dust and moisture thanks to the IP68 standard. It can withstand depths of up to 1.5 meters, but only for half an hour.

All elements are in their usual places, the finger finds them easily. Thus, the lock button has found its place on the right edge, while the volume control is placed on the left edge. In front, under the display, there is a physical key with a fingerprint reader embedded in it and touch navigation buttons on the sides, everything is familiar. Above the screen we see a front-facing peephole, a notification indicator, an iris scanner, the necessary sensors and a speech speaker. At the bottom end there is a call speaker, a connector (USB v3.1), a microphone, a 3.5 mm headphone input and a niche for the S Pen. On the top edge there is a second microphone and a hybrid tray for microSD and SIM cards or two SIM cards. Device dimensions - 153.5 × 73.9 × 7.9 mm. Weight does not exceed 169 grams. There are five types of colors available - blue, gold, silver and black.

The phablet has acquired the best display to date with a size of 5.7 inches, which, by the way, occupies 78 percent of the front panel. It is hidden under durable Gorilla Glass 5, based on the proprietary SuperAMOLED matrix, the resolution rests at 2560 × 1440 pixels (Quad HD). There is no question of any visible pixels, because their density per inch is 518 ppi. The brightness, viewing angles and color are simply amazing. The color temperature can be adjusted to suit your needs. Although the screen is practically frameless, there are no accidental clicks. As in smartphones of the family, there is an Always-on-Display mode, so the clock and various information are constantly displayed. Many will be pleased with the presence of the “Blue Filter” option; using it, you can make the color gamut of the display warmer. As for the updated S Pen, its tip has become twice as thin for more comfortable drawing. Also, the stylus now recognizes 4096 degrees of pressure.

Technical features and autonomy of the Samsung Galaxy Note 7

The “heart” of the device is the Exynos 8890 Octa processor. This 14nm chipset has the highest performance. It includes four cores at 1.6 GHz and four at 2.3 GHz. The Mali-T880 MP12 graphics module is installed. The LPDDR4 RAM has a capacity of 4 GB, and the built-in UFS 2.0 flash drive has a capacity of 64 GB. The size of the memory card is unlimited. This incredible performance will be enough for the next few years. In AnTuTu, the device has a corresponding result - about 145 thousand points. The device is equipped with a wide range of different sensors. For the first time, Samsung smartphones use an iris sensor, which replaces the fingerprint sensor. The user can choose between these two unlocking methods. In addition, on board the Galaxy Note 7 there is a gyroscope, barometer, Hall sensor, heart rate meter and compass. Of course, 4G LTE frequencies and navigation using GPS and GLONASS systems are supported. It's worth noting that unlocking with your eyes takes less than a second, even if you're wearing glasses, just look at the screen. A very convenient thing.

The battery in the device is non-removable, its capacity is 3500 mAh, which is 500 mAh more than last year’s model. The battery life is good, as for a smartphone with top-end hardware. The battery allows you to operate the device for up to two days in active mode. For example, at maximum brightness the video plays for about 20 hours. An energy saving function is provided. Wireless charging available. There is also a fast charging mode; half the battery capacity is gained in 20 minutes.

Appearance and ergonomics

Back in the Galaxy S6, Samsung found its own smartphone design recipe - and has been following it without deviation for a year and a half. I must admit, the recipe is really good: take a thin body, cover it with tempered glass on both sides, and put metal around the perimeter; Place an oval button with a fingerprint scanner at the bottom of the front panel; if necessary, bend the edges of the body. In Note 7, this scheme is brought to perfection - the edges of the glass are curved both on the front side and on the back, which makes the smartphone not only visually symmetrical, but also, excuse the cliche, fits perfectly in the hand.

The latter is really impressive - when operating a 5.7-inch gadget you do not experience any serious discomfort, the sensations are quite comparable to those you had when working with the S7, and much more pleasant than when working with the edge. Except, of course, that you have to work with both hands - you can, of course, activate a special “one-handed” mode, with picture in picture - but this, to be honest, is not very convenient. The Note 7 is also difficult to fit into a pocket. Of course, there are different pockets, but I tried several - from all of them the smartphone stuck out at least slightly. However, all this is an inevitable feature of all large smartphones, which are also called the terrible word “phablet”.

Samsung Galaxy Note 7, front panel. Above the screen: earpiece, front camera, light and proximity sensors, infrared iris recognition camera, and status indicator. Below the screen: the “Home” button with a fingerprint scanner and touch keys for “Back” and calling up a list of open applications

Unfortunately, the Note 7 only looks flawless in photographs and display cases. No, it doesn't turn into a pumpkin after purchase, but the glass back panel does pick up fingerprints very easily. This is not too critical if, as in our case, you have a black version. If you have blue or silver, get your rags ready, gentlemen and ladies. The olephobic coating helps quickly erase marks, but does not protect the case from collecting them.

Both the display and the back panel use Gorilla Glass 5, which theoretically should not react at all to the touch of keys or small change in your pocket. In practice, things are not so great. The glass can probably withstand falls from a small height, but it scratches like crazy. For the back panel to get scratched, you don’t even need to carry your smartphone with keys - you just need to put it on less than perfectly smooth surfaces from time to time. There is no loss of functionality, but it doesn't look great.

The layout and shape of the keys is identical to what we saw on the Galaxy S7: two volume buttons on the left and a power button on the right. You need to get used to this; on almost all other Android smartphones they fall together on the right side. Under the display there is a mechanical Home button with a built-in fingerprint scanner, with which you can unlock the device in one motion - this is a fairly common solution, and very convenient to boot.

Note 7 is the first Samsung smartphone and the first smartphone in general since the Lumia 950, which has a built-in iris scanner.

The infrared sensor is located above the screen and can quickly recognize the owner; you just need to bring the device at a distance of 25-30 cm to your eyes. Another thing is that, unlike a fingerprint scanner, you first need to press the power button and swipe the lock screen - and then also bring the smartphone in an unnatural position to your face. You also need to take off your glasses and contact lenses, carefully monitor the cleanliness of the sensor and endure for a long time while the device memorizes the shape of your eyes: personally, it remembered mine on the 19th (I counted) attempt - it took at least five rather dreary minutes. But forging an iris, unlike a fingerprint, is much more difficult. However, there is always a verification PIN code - if you really want to, you can bypass such strict protection.

By the way, I won’t write separately about the fingerprint scanner - they have reached such a level that they work equally quickly in both expensive and cheap devices, and when you come across a scanner in a smartphone for 10 thousand (like Vernee Thor), you’re not even surprised. In general, it is here too, and it works quickly, without failures.

The case, like the S7, is protected according to the IP68 standard (up to half an hour at a depth of one and a half meters) - you don’t have to worry about splashes and accidental drowning in a sink, the sea or somewhere else. Since Sony refused to produce devices protected by the same standard, this can be called a Samsung signature feature. In terms of body thickness, by the way, Note 7 is identical to the “regular” S7 and two tenths of a millimeter thicker than the S7 edge.

The same small problem with the speaker remained. It is monophonic, located on the bottom edge, and can be clearly heard when the smartphone is lying flat - but as soon as you pick it up, especially in landscape orientation, the tiny grille is blocked by your finger and it is no longer possible to hear anything. You have to carefully choose a place for your finger and place it on the stylus hidden in the case.

Software,SPen

While working on the Note 7, Samsung changed the name of its Android shell. The long-standing TouchWiz has been replaced by Grace UX. Moreover, at first glance it seems that, apart from the name and the settings menu, nothing has changed. This is a deceptive impression - although the changes are not dramatic, they make using the device much more comfortable in small ways.

First of all, after a relatively long period of use, you notice that the smartphone no longer consumes energy in standby mode, like fire - oxygen. Leaving your Note 7 unplugged overnight will prevent you from finding it dead the next morning. On the contrary, a maximum of 5-7% will be lost, or even less. Another key problem of TouchWiz also disappeared - along with a bunch of pre-installed proprietary applications that had to be forcibly “demolished” (and some were completely impossible to remove). Now the required software is a minimum; everything you need can be downloaded yourself either from Google Play or from the Samsung application store. True, the process of first launch with the need to first log into a Google account, then into a Samsung account and sign up for a lot of different agreements was still too long.

Iris scanner

In addition to the fingerprint scanner, Note7 adds another level of protection – an eye scanner. You add your eyes once, and then the smartphone unlocks by scanning them. And even in complete darkness. If you look straight, it works very quickly, sometimes you don’t even have time to notice how the scanner turned on. But overall, it’s just a cool feature; it’s unlikely to become a very popular unlocking method, just like face unlock in Android.

S Pen

The electronic S-Pen has become a little better in hardware. In particular, the thickness of the rod itself has almost halved - to 0.7 mm, and pressure gradations are now recognized up to 4000. This is twice as much as in the two previous generations, but this is unlikely to help you, it seems to me.

But some software things are more pleasing. What I liked most was the ability to make a GIF from any selected area, be it a menu interface or a video. Here's what happens:

The pen can also serve as a magnifying glass (I can’t imagine any use cases, to be honest), all the previous features remain. I don’t remember if this was possible before, but there is definitely an icon for adding a new item to the stylus drop-down fan. And a whole store for adding items.
